1
The LORD said to Moses, "Depart; go up from here, you 1and the people whom you have brought up out of the land of Egypt, to the land of which I swore to Abraham, Isaac, and Jacob, saying, 'To 2your offspring I will give it.'
2
I will send an 3angel before you, 4and I will drive out the Canaanites, the Amorites, the Hittites, the Perizzites, the Hivites, and the Jebusites.
35Go up to a land flowing with milk and honey; 6but I will not go up among you, 7lest I consume you on the way, for you are a 8stiff-necked people."
4
When the people heard this disastrous word, they 9mourned, and 10no one put on his ornaments.
5
For the LORD had said to Moses, "Say to the people of Israel, 'You are a 11stiff-necked people; if for a single moment I should go up among you, I would 12consume you. So now 13take off your ornaments, that I may know what to do with you.'"
6
Therefore the people of Israel stripped themselves of their ornaments, from Mount Horeb onward.
